We have a fixed-term opportunity for someone with the right experience to be part of our dynamic neuro outpatient rehabilitation service.

Would you like to be part of a dedicated, energetic and creative team of people who are entrusted with the assessment and rehabilitation of those newly diagnosed or living with neurological condition in our community by supporting their safety and functional independence to get well, live well or stay well in their community, if so please get in touch with us to discuss.

Our ideal candidate will be flexible, with an ability to work autonomously and within both inter-professional and multidisciplinary models of care. We want a 'can do' person who has a passion for doing whatever it takes to improve the lives of those needing our service.

No two days will look the same, there will never be a shortage of work but we will have lots of fun along the way and provide a great team spirit.

This position involves working with people both in an outpatient environment and in their own homes.

Our jobs are very serious and have huge impacts on the lives of others but along the way you will build relationships and comradeship with the team who will support you in your everyday work.

Engage Community Allied Health Service employ over 40 staff including Occupational Therapists, Physiotherapists, Social Workers, Dietitians, Speech Language Therapists, and Therapy Assistants who work together to achieve the best outcomes for our health consumers.

You will be supported by the engAGE Team Leader, the Professional Lead and an amazing team of Neuro Therapists.

If you need any other reasons to work for us then consider the more than 2350 hours of sunshine Hawke's Bay gets a year, fresh produce, vineyards, art deco and the ocean right on our front door step. A fixed-term opportunity gives you the chance to experience 'us'.

New Zealand registration current annual practicing certificate and current driving license are essential.
